初めまして。
会社でsambaサーバーを構築中のかおりです。

サーバーの各フォルダにアクセス制御をかけるため、課単位でユーザーをグルーピングし、 それぞれのフォルダに権限を与えようとしているところです。
最初に部単位で各ユーザーに制限を与えるため、下記のように総務部と生産部のグループを作り、smb.confにもこのように書いたまではいいんですが、このフォルダより下に権限を与えることはできるのでしょうか?
例えば、下記フォルダで/soumuフォルダは総務課ユーザーのみRW、他のユーザー(人事課、生産部)はRのみ。
/seisan1フォルダは生産1課ユーザーはRW、他のユーザー(総務部、生産2課)はRのみという設定にしたいのです。
どなたかわかる方いらっしゃいませんか?
参考までに各種設定内容を添付します。

/soumubu 総務部
/soumu 総務課
/jinji 人事課
/seisanbu 生産部
/seisan1 生産1課
/seisan2 生産2課

■passwd
soumu01::60001:510::/home/users:/bin/bash
soumu02::60002:510::/home/users:/bin/bash
seisan01::61001:520::/home/users:/bin/bash
seisan02::61002:520::/home/users:/bin/bash

■group
soumubu:x:510:
soumu:x:511:
jinji:x:512:
seisanbu:x:520:
seisan1:x:521:
seisan2:x:522:

■smb.conf
[soumubu]
comment = Soumubu
path = /soumubu
public = no
writable = no
printable = no
write list = @soumubu

[seisanbu]
comment = Seisanbu
path = /seisanbu
public = no
writable = no
printable = no
write list = @seisanbu

以上、よろしくお願いします。

A 回答 (1件)

smb.confのGlobalセッションでsecurtyをUSERにして



chgrp と chmod でパーミッションを各ディレクトリに設定すれば良いのではないでしょうか?

chgrp soumubu /soumubu
chmod 764 /soumubu

ってなかんじで
    • good
    • 0
この回答へのお礼

早速の回答、ありがとうございます。
最初は「chgrpってなに?」と思いましたが(私の持ってる説明書に載ってなかったため)、調べていくうちにやっとわかりました。
この時点でまた質問があるんですけど、新しく登録します。
ありがとうございました。

お礼日時:2001/02/05 16:09

お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!


このカテゴリの人気Q&Aランキング

おすすめ情報